Linux NI-DAQmx Base 64-bit application support?

Solved!
Go to solution

I'm running Scientific Linux 6.x developing custom applications that utilize data transmitted/acquired via PCI-6259 cards. Recently the application is approaching the 3.5 or so gig RAM limit with 32 bit applications. We're using NI-DAQmx Base 3.6.0 installed in fall of 2012 so I figured maybe there was a newer version of the driver that supported 64-bit applications. It appears that version 15 (the most recent version for Linux) still does not. I noticed that NI-DAQmx 16.1 for Windows does support 64-bit applications, though. Does anyone on here know the time-table for release of a driver with 64-bit application compatibility for Linux?

Hi James,

 

NI-DAQmx Base 15.0 for Linux did add 64-bit usermode support for LabVIEW and C applications. It appears that the readme and download page weren't fully updated to reflect that :-S
